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of pig trotter processing equipment, in particular to a quick pig trotter dicing device which comprises a dicing platform and an electric bone sawing machine arranged on the dicing platform, a protective cover is arranged on the dicing platform, the dicing platform is provided with two conveying belts, and the two conveying belts are distributed on the two sides of the electric bone sawing machine. Four driving wheels are rotationally mounted on the dicing platform, the four driving wheels drive the two conveying belts to rotate synchronously and reversely, the pushing component is arranged at the bottom of the dicing platform, and the pig trotters are driven by the pushing component to move towards the electric bone sawing machine. The pushing component is used for pushing the trotters to pass through the two conveying belts, then the designed positioning component is used for making contact with the trotters, the conveying belts are further adjusted, when the trotters are conveyed, the tops and the two sides of the trotters are positioned, and it is guaranteed that when the trotters are divided into two parts through the electric bone sawing machine, the sizes of the two parts of the trotters are uniform.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of pig trotter processing equipment, in particular to a rapid dicing device for pig trotters. BACKGROUND

[0002] Pig trotter, also known as pig foot or pig hand, is the end part of pig's four limbs, including hoof and lower leg part. When it is used as food material in a restaurant, it needs to be cut into uniform pieces in advance.

[0003] At present, when pig trotters are diced, they need to be cut vertically into two parts first, and then cut into 5-6 cm blocks at equal intervals. The existing dicing equipment usually needs personnel to put the pig trotter into a cylinder and then press the cutter to cut it into two parts when cutting the pig trotter vertically into two parts. However, since the size of each pig trotter is different, the cylinder is set to be larger, which causes the pig trotter placed in the cylinder to be in an inclined state, making the two halves of the pig trotter different in size when cut open, and the subsequent dicing is uneven, which is not conducive to subsequent hotel food preparation. Since the size needs to be controlled equally in hotels and other places, the size control is particularly important. SUMMARY

[0004] The present application aims to provide a rapid dicing device for pig trotters to solve the problem of uneven two halves when cutting the pig trotter vertically into two parts as mentioned in the background.

[0019] Example 1: Please refer to Figure 1 - Figure 5 The diagram shows a rapid slicing device for pig trotters, including a slicing platform 1 with a protective cover 2, an electric bone saw 3 mounted on the slicing platform 1, two conveyor belts 4 distributed on both sides of the electric bone saw 3, four drive wheels 5 rotatably mounted on the slicing platform 1 driving the two conveyor belts 4 to rotate synchronously in reverse, a pushing component 6 at the bottom of the slicing platform 1 to move the pig trotters toward the electric bone saw 3, and several positioning components 7 mounted on the slicing platform 1 to position the outer side of the pig trotters so that the middle part is aligned with the electric bone saw 3. In this design, two conveyor belts 4, in conjunction with a pushing component 6, move the pig's trotter toward the electric bone saw 3. While moving, a positioning component 7 positions the top and sides of the pig's trotter to ensure stable movement during cutting, preventing it from tilting or lifting. This ensures that the two halves of the pig's trotter are of uniform size after cutting, resulting in smaller differences in the size of the subsequent cut pieces, meeting the needs of hotel food preparation. The drive wheels 5 on the two conveyor belts 4 are driven by an external motor, causing the two conveyor belts 4 to rotate synchronously in opposite directions, assisting the pig's trotter in moving toward the electric bone saw 3.

[0022] The principle of positioning component 7 for positioning the top and sides of the pig's hoof is as follows: First, the pushing component 6 moves the pig's hoof towards the electric bone saw 3. At the same time, the two conveyor belts 4 rotate synchronously to assist the pig's hoof in moving towards the electric bone saw 3. During the movement, the bottom of the inclined pressing plate 20 contacts the top of the pig's hoof, which can prevent the pig's hoof from lifting up during cutting and limit the alignment of the top. At the same time, the push bar 27 presses the inclined plate 26, which causes the push plate 25 to press the conveyor belt 4. The two conveyor belts 4 limit the sides of the pig's hoof, which can keep the pig's hoof moving steadily towards the electric bone saw 3 and prevent it from tilting during the movement. This ensures that the two halves of the pig's hoof cut into pieces by the electric bone saw 3 are of uniform size, which is helpful for subsequent cutting operations.

[0023] It should be noted that, considering the length of pig trotters, multiple positioning components 7 are provided, which are evenly distributed on the cutting platform 1 to ensure that at least one pig trotter passes completely through the electric bone saw 3.

[0024] It should also be noted that for some large pig hooves, when passing over the pressing plate 20, their large size will cause the pressing rod 19 to be lifted. At this time, the entire U-shaped support 13 will move upward, causing the abutment rod 27 to move upward. Under the action of the tension spring 28, the abutment plate 25 will retract a certain distance, relaxing the sides of the pig hoof by a certain distance. While satisfying the positioning of the sides of the pig hoof, it is convenient for large pig hooves to pass through.

[0025] This method involves precisely cutting the pig's trotters in half, including the following steps: The first step is for the staff to place the pig's feet, with the electric bone saw 3 facing the cutting platform 1; The second step involves moving the pig's trotter toward the electric bone saw 3 by operating the pusher 6, while the two conveyor belts 4 rotate in opposite directions to assist in the movement of the pig's trotter. The third step involves the pressing part 17 and the abutting part 18 during the movement of the pig's hoof, thereby limiting the top and sides of the pig's hoof.

[0026] The fourth step involves using an electric bone saw 3 to vertically cut the pig's trotters in half.

[0027] In this solution, the pig's trotter is first pushed by the pushing component 6 and the two conveyor belts 4 to move it toward the electric bone saw 3. During the cutting process, the pressing component 17 and the abutting part 18 are used to keep it in the state of movement, so that it will not lift or shift, thus ensuring that when it is vertically cut into two halves, the two halves of the pig's trotter are of uniform size.
